Notes. The H2 masses from CO observations are measured within the CO beams. For extended galaxies, we also consider the estimated total CO emission (see Sect. 3.2 for details). (a) Ratio of our adopted XCO value to the Galactic value XCO,gal. To bracket the range of molecular gas masses, there are two lines for each galaxy corresponding to the molecular masses derived with two values of the XCO factor: XCO = XCO,gal (lower mass case) and XCO = XCO,Z ∝ Z-2 (upper mass case). (b)R21 is the CO(2–1)/CO(1–0) ratio. (c)R31 is the CO(3–2)/CO(1–0) ratio.
